Germ Cell
Immature reproductive cell; gives rise to haploid gametes when it divides.
Chromosome Number
The total count of chromosomes present in the nucleus of a cell, which varies across different species and is crucial for genetics.
Human Cells
The basic structural, functional, and biological units of the human body, essential for all life processes.
Meiosis
A type of cell division that reduces the chromosomal number by half, leading to the production of gametes in sexually reproducing organisms.
